Australian Building Permits MoM Prel (Feb) M/M 29.7% vs. Exp. 6.2% (Prev. -7.2%)
The preliminary reading of Australian building permits for February showed a surprising monthly increase of 29.7%, significantly exceeding expectations of 6.2%.
